Breaking up a previous multi gun listing into single listings

John Robertson (Boss) 12ga sxs boxlock ejector. Serial # 6689 or 6899 ? Early 1900’s. It’s tight as new and beautiful for its age. 30” barrels, 14” LOP. Neutral cast. I do have 2-1/2” no 5 and no 6 shot which is equivalent to US 6 or 7 shot included shipped to your home address. $5000.00 OBO
